HP Mini 2140 Notebook is tiny, aluminum, gorgeous and cheap
Here is a small 2.6-pounder, which is almost small enough to be called Netbook. The HP 2140 Mini-Notebook PC 10.1-inch display is LED backlighting, and with its optional 80-GB solid-state drive and small, low-power Intel Atom processor, it is the right packaging all Tech.
The keyboard is not too small either, it’s 92 percent the size of a full-size keyboard. And hey, it’s made of aluminum, making it super-chic. It is surprising, in the same time, it’s super cheap. Available in late January.
